17 Facts About Rich Robinson

facts about rich robinson.html1.

Richard Robinson was born on May 24,1969 and is an American musician and founding member of the rock and roll band the Black Crowes.

2.

At age 15, Rich wrote the music for "She Talks to Angels", which became one of the band's biggest hits.

3.

Rich Robinson is the son of Nancy Jane and Stanley "Stan" Robinson.

4.

Rich Robinson has stated that, because of his young age, he would have to sneak in and out the venues they performed and would be refused admittance if he returned the next day to attend a gig himself.

5.

Rich Robinson handled most of the songwriting, with Hogg contributing lyric and melody ideas to some material.

6.

Rich Robinson continued to tour throughout the end of 2003 and well into 2004.

7.

Rich Robinson's band featured a consistently rotating line-up, with drummer Bill Dobrow and bassist Gordie Johnson being the only fairly regular faces.

8.

Rich Robinson handled guitar, bass, and other instruments as well as taking over the lead vocals, with the gaps being filled in by Joe Magistro, Eddie Harsch, Donnie Herron and his own son Taylor Rich Robinson.

9.

Rich Robinson played dulcimer on "The Boy In the Bubble" and guitar on "Midnight Rider".

10.

In late November, 2013, Rich Robinson announced via his Facebook page that he had signed with independent record label The End Records, which would be releasing his third solo album, The Ceaseless Sight.

11.

In 2016 Rich Robinson joined Bad Company as a temporary, live substitute for guitarist Mick Ralphs on their 2016 US tour co-headlining with Joe Walsh.

12.

In October 2016, Rich Robinson formed The Magpie Salute with other former Black Crowes members Marc Ford, Sven Pipien and Eddie Harsch.

13.

In January 2005, Chris and Rich Robinson played an acoustic show together in Las Vegas, Nevada.

14.

Rich Robinson joined back up with the Crowes to finish out 2005 with three shows including a New Year's Eve show at Madison Square Garden in New York.

15.

On January 15,2015, Rich Robinson announced the final breakup of the band due to a disagreement with his brother over an alleged proposal regarding ownership of the band.

16.

In Guitar World's "30 on 30: The Greatest Guitarists Picked by the Greatest Guitarists", Rich Robinson picked Peter Green as his all-time favorite guitar player.
